Also with Verizon you cant talk and use data at the same time.
So what do you do when you're home tethering to a bunch of devices or streaming or downloading a file and someone decides to call?
The call interrupts everything and you either wait till it stops ringing and goes to voicemail to use data again or take the call and use the internet later when you hang up.
Either way I wouldn't put so much stress on my phone to make it as a 24hour home wireless router. It eats up lots of battery to tether and to constantly charge and tether for many hours a day would destroy the battery and most likely cause issues with the phone down the road.
